Handover: Payroll Export Change

Welcome aboard. As of the Quill 4.2 release, the payroll export for Lanternworks switched from fixed-width records to delimited batches, and the rounding rules for overtime now apply before tax splits, not after. Old downstream jobs in the Fenwick pipeline still expect the legacy layout, so keep the compatibility flag on until finance confirms. The complete migration checklist and field mapping live on this page:

operations page: https://jenkins.zemvarcloud.local/job/merge_requests/repo/build/73930b4b30f0a8ed

Scope: duplicate-charge complaints, stuck retries, key-conflict errors (code PK-409). Do not advise customers to retry manually; the Paywicket client regenerates keys incorrectly in versions before 4.2. First steps: pull the transaction trace, confirm whether the key was reused or expired, note the gateway region. Key TTL is 24 hours; anything older is expected to conflict. Escalations owned by the Paywicket core team, weekdays, Harborlight time. For key-conflict escalations and trace reviews, write to the address below.

escalation mailbox, bafog-fafog: ulador@paliqlabs.internal

Insurance Renewal — Managers Only

For the incoming director: our combined liability and property cover with Thornleigh Mutual renews at the end of next quarter. Premium quoted up 9%, reflecting the Caldmere warehouse expansion. Alternative quotes from two brokers are on file; neither beats the incumbent once cargo cover is included. Renewal decision is due within thirty days. The relevant planning context follows below.

confidential, bahap-bajog: Zorethix Works is in early talks to buy Kelethox Foods for about $30.7 million. The Ralvan launch date is September 19, and nothing goes to the press before then.

## Deployment

The Parcelhawk webhook receiver runs as a single stateless container behind the Norfell gateway. Inbound calls must be signed; unsigned payloads are dropped before parsing. Rotate the signing secret on every deploy. Outbound retries are capped at five with exponential backoff. No payload bodies are logged. Review the deployed configuration below before sign-off.

deployment values, kajep-kageg:
[praix]
host = praix.paliqcorp.corp
user = praix_svc
database = praix_prod